We do a lot of visuals. I'm not in pit anymore but they still do a lot of visuals. The only rules we have to abide by is that it must complement the music. We have done a bow and arrow visual when we had rests in the drum solo and have done cool ways to bring our mallets up to play. After the last battery hit in this years show the whole drum line and pit makes an x with our sticks/mallets over our heads while we slowly bring it down to our sides. It looks sweet!
